1. JOB PURPOSE
UNO Energies is seeking a qualified and highly motivated Quantity Surveyor with AutoCAD & Drafting Skills to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for interpreting construction drawings, preparing accurate Bills of Quantities (BOQ) and producing technical drawings to support project planning and execution.
2.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
A. Quantity Surveying
•     Review and analyse architectural and engineering drawings.
•     Prepare detailed Bills of Quantities (BOQ).
•     Conduct material take-offs and ensure accuracy in measurements.
•     Monitor and manage project materials across multiple sites in line with the prepared BOQ.
•      Assist in estimate preparation, evaluation, and contract administration.
•      Provide cost control and value engineering recommendations.
B. AutoCAD & Drafting
•      Create, edit, and update technical drawings using AutoCAD.
•      Draft construction details, layouts, and plans as required.
• Ensure drawings comply with industry standards and project specifications.
•      Collaborate with engineers and architects to refine designs.
